Burkitt’s lymphoma with placental invasion diagnosed at cesarean delivery: a case report
Abstract Background Burkitt’s lymphoma is a highly aggressive B cell non-Hodgkin lymphoma subtype. Its occurrence in pregnancy is rare and often results in a delayed diagnosis.
